Received this along with a 3D printed mat for my 9 year old. First, as with all of these 3D pens, it really takes a lot of practice before you get good results. However, this device really works. It heats up very quickly and installing the filament was pretty easy. You can leave the floss between uses, but make sure not to use the back button until the unit has warmed up. The packaging was pretty and included some starter PLA. Problems: 1. The speed button is weird. The slowest speed does not eject the filament at all and the highest speed is too slow2. There is no stand, the lack of a small piece of plastic means there is nowhere to put the pen3. The tip is plastic and has a habit of catching plastic on the way out. That's not typical of this pen, but the best pens have metal tips that make it much easier to remove stuck plastic.
